Traveling by train from Cuenca to Albacete is an efficient and comfortable option, offering a pleasant journey through the scenic landscapes of Spain. The distance between Cuenca and Albacete is approximately 75 miles (122 km) and the average train journey duration is around 31m.
The Cuenca to Albacete train line offers a frequency of 12 departures per day, ensuring regular service throughout the week. Trains operate daily, providing convenience whether you are planning to travel on a weekday or over the weekend.
For early risers or those looking to maximize their day, the first train typically departs at 05:40, allowing for an early start. Meanwhile, for those preferring to travel later in the day, the last train usually leaves at 22:00. This Cuenca to Albacete train schedule ensures flexibility for both leisure and business travelers looking to make the most of their journey.
Passengers board the train most frequently from Cuenca–Fernando Zóbel, which is located around 3.8 miles (6.1 km) away from the city centre, and they get off the train at Albacete-Los Llanos, located 1.4 miles (2.2 km) away from the city centre.
